LOS ANGELES – Jamey Simpson remembers getting phone calls from his mother when she was on the Space Station.
The experience, both mother and son admit, was amazing. What they didn’t realize was what effect the time away might have on each other. Acting upFootage shows Simpson acting up and disrespecting his grandmother, a clear sign he was frustrated. But those instances are secondary to the coping mechanisms they embraced. Time, Simpson says, had different meaning to him as a child. “I can very vividly remember my mom explained to me, ‘Not when you’re in first grade, second grade or third grade but when you’re in fourth grade, I’m going to the Space Station.’ I quantified time in terms of the school year.”Because his parents had instilled in him the value of Coleman’s work , it wasn’t likely that would set up barriers. “That just wasn’t in the equation,” Simpson says.
